High-precision CD measurement using energy-filtering SEM techniques

Voltage contrast (VC) images obtained using an energy filter (EF) were used to measure the bottom surface of high-aspect-ratio structures. The VC images obtained using the conventional EF were sensitive to variations in wafer potential. Since CD-SEM metrology …
